Shaving Pen Market Overview

The global shaving pen market size was valued at USD 1.42 billion in 2024 and is projected to grow from USD 1.51 billion in 2025 to reach USD 2.44 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 6.22% during the forecast period (2025–2033). The market growth is fueled by rising demand for personal grooming solutions, increasing aesthetic awareness, and the convenience offered by portable and precise shaving tools.

A major driver of the global market is the surging influence of social media and grooming content shared by beauty influencers and professional barbers. Plat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ube showcase shaving pens being used for detailed beard shaping, eyebrow styling, and creative hair designs. These videos highlight the precision and ease of use of shaving pens, encouraging viewers to try them at home.

Simultaneously, professional grooming services and barbershops are increasingly using shaving pens to deliver sharp, clean finishes that appeal to customers seeking trendy looks. This professional endorsement builds trust and awareness among consumers. Additionally, collaborations between manufacturers and stylists or barbers for co-branded marketing further elevate the product's profile. As consumer interest in at-home grooming and styling rises, the visibility and perceived value of shaving pens continue to grow across various demographics.

Emerging Market Trend

Rising Popularity of Precision Grooming Tools for Eyebrows, Nose, and Ear Hair

The global market is witnessing a significant shift towards precision grooming tools, driven by consumer demand for clean, detailed, and professional-looking results at home. As grooming becomes more personalized, tools that cater to specific areas, like eyebrows, nose, and ear hair, are gaining prominence. This trend aligns with the broader surge in beauty tech and minimalist grooming devices that are easy to use and portable.

  • For instance, in January 2024, Beurer launched the MN2X Precision Trimmer at Arab Health, targeting fine detailing for eyebrows, nose, and ear hair. Designed in a sleek, pen-style form, it offers compact, user-friendly grooming with German-engineered blades. The product reflects growing consumer demand for precision grooming tools, especially in the personal care electronics segment.

As convenience, hygiene, and aesthetics continue to converge, precision grooming pens are becoming essential for grooming.

Shaving Pen Market Driver

Increasing Demand for Personal Grooming and Aesthetics

The global market is witnessing robust growth due to rising awareness of personal grooming and aesthetics, particularly among younger consumers. Grooming has transcended from being a female-centric activity to a gender-neutral lifestyle choice, with both men and women seeking precision tools for facial styling, eyebrow shaping, and defined hairlines. Shaving pens offer a compact, precise, and user-friendly solution for individuals seeking salon-like results at home.

  • According to a 2023 survey by Euromonitor, 72% of men aged 18–35 globally consider grooming an essential part of their daily routine, reflecting a strong cultural shift toward personal care. This trend highlights growing male engagement in skincare, facial styling, and overall aesthetic maintenance.

As consumers increasingly prioritize appearances for personal, social, and professional reasons, the demand for advanced grooming products like shaving pens continues to surge.

Market Restraint

Limited Product Awareness in Emerging Economies

One of the key restraints in the global market is the limited product awareness in emerging economies. Consumers in these regions often rely on conventional grooming tools such as razors and trimmers, primarily due to familiarity, affordability, and limited exposure to advanced personal care devices.

The shaving pen, being a relatively niche product, lacks widespread marketing and retail presence in countries across Asia, Africa, and Latin America. Additionally, the absence of strong local distributors and educational campaigns about its benefits further hinders adoption. As a result, the market remains underpenetrated in these regions, slowing down the overall growth potential despite rising grooming awareness.

Market Opportunity

Product Diversification and Unisex Offerings

The evolving landscape of personal grooming emphasizes inclusivity and convenience, driving brands to develop unisex shaving pens with diversified functions. Consumers increasingly prefer grooming tools that offer precision for multiple uses, such as facial hair detailing, eyebrow shaping, and body grooming, regardless of gender.

  • For instance, in January 2024, Philips Norelco launched the OneBlade Intimate, a unisex grooming tool designed for both men and women to manage pubic and underarm hair. This marked the brand’s first product in the U.S. that completely transcends traditional gender labeling in shaving products, responding directly to retail feedback that women often browsed men’s aisles in search of personal grooming tools.

Such innovations reflect the growing demand for versatile, inclusive products. By embracing this trend, manufacturers can expand their market reach and cater to diverse grooming needs across global consumer segments.


Regional Analysis

North America dominated the shaving pen industry in 2024 with a 46% share, driven by rising demand for advanced grooming tools and growing self-care routines among both men and women. High disposable incomes, tech-savvy consumers, and a strong presence of premium personal care brands are supporting market expansion. Social media-driven grooming trends and a surge in e-commerce purchases further propel demand. Additionally, growing adoption of unisex grooming tools and innovative designs is boosting consumer engagement, particularly among younger demographics seeking precision styling solutions.

  • The United States shaving pen market is witnessing steady growth due to high consumer interest in advanced grooming tools. The rsurge of influencer marketing and self-care trends is fueling demand, especially among Gen Z. Brands like Wahl and MicroTouch are popular for their precision pens. Retailers such as Target and Amazon offer a broad range of shaving pens, supporting market expansion through accessibility and competitive pricing.
  • Canada’s market is growing as consumers prioritize clean grooming tools for beard detailing and eyebrow shaping. With rising awareness of skincare and grooming, brands like Philips and Conair are gaining traction. The popularity of unisex grooming tools has also boosted demand. Retailers like Shoppers Drug Mart and Walmart Canada are offering online deals and promotions, making shaving pens accessible to a broader audience across urban and suburban regions.

Europe Market Trends

Europe's market is driven by a heightened focus on personal hygiene and appearance, particularly among urban populations. Consumers increasingly prefer sleek, minimalist grooming tools like shaving pens that offer precision and ease of use. The region’s strong beauty and cosmetics culture fosters innovation in product design and marketing. The rising popularity of gender-neutral grooming and sustainable products also supports market expansion. Retailers and brands benefit from a robust online and offline distribution network, allowing greater consumer access to specialized grooming tools and contributing to consistent market growth.

  • Germany’s shaving pen market is witnessing steady growth driven by increased consumer focus on precision grooming and high-quality personal care tools. German consumers prioritize durability and engineering, favoring brands like Philips and Braun that offer advanced grooming pens. The growing popularity of beard styling and clean facial contours among young professionals is supporting market demand. Online platforms like Douglas and Flaconi further boost accessibility to a variety of shaving pens.
  • The UK’s market for shaving penis thriving due to the rising male grooming trend and growing demand for multipurpose beauty tools. British consumers, influenced by fashion and social media trends, are embracing shaving pens for detailing beards and eyebrow shaping. Brands like Wilkinson Sword and Wahl are expanding their product range with precision trimmers. Retailers such as Boots and Amazon UK are driving strong e-commerce sales in the shaving pen segment.

Asia-Pacific Market Trends

Asia Pacific is experiencing significant growth in the global market, fueled by rising grooming consciousness among youth and growing beauty industry investments. The increasing penetration of social media platforms promotes grooming trends that favor detailed facial hair styling and eyebrow shaping. The region’s large population, expanding urbanization, and affordability of shaving pens attract new consumer segments. Rapid growth in online retail channels and beauty-focused mobile apps also makes these products more accessible. Additionally, a shift toward modern grooming practices in both urban and semi-urban areas is amplifying demand.

  • China's market is witnessing rapid growth driven by the surging disposable incomes and a growing emphasis on personal grooming among urban men and women. The popularity of apps like Xiaohongshu has encouraged consumers to adopt precision beauty tools, including shaving pens. Brands such as Xiaomi and Flyco are launching ergonomic, rechargeable variants, targeting tech-savvy youth seeking affordable, multifunctional grooming devices for facial and eyebrow styling.
  • India's market is expanding due to increasing grooming awareness among the younger population and a boom in beauty vlogging. Urban consumers, particularly in metro cities like Mumbai and Bengaluru, are embracing shaving pens for beard detailing and eyebrow shaping. Brands such as Vega and Bombay Shaving Company have introduced cost-effective pens through e-commerce platforms like Nykaa and Amazon, catering to the rising demand for convenient, unisex grooming solutions.

Type Insights

The electric shaving pens segment is witnessing growing demand due to its convenience, precision, and ease of use. These pens are preferred for quick grooming, especially for facial detailing, as they offer consistent results without requiring shaving cream or water. With rechargeable options and features like LED lighting and multiple trimming heads, they are ideal for modern consumers. Their popularity is rising among tech-savvy individuals and frequent travelers seeking efficient, portable grooming tools.

Application Insights

Eyebrow shaping is a key application segment in the market, driven by increasing aesthetic consciousness among both men and women. Shaving pens provide a pain-free alternative to tweezing or waxing, allowing users to achieve defined brows at home. Their precision tips and ergonomic design make them ideal for removing fine hair without irritation. With the influence of beauty trends and makeup tutorials, demand for eyebrow-specific grooming tools like shaving pens continues to rise globally.

End-User Insights

The men segment holds a prominent share in the global market owing to the rising focus on beard grooming, hairline detailing, and overall facial aesthetics. Shaving pens cater to men seeking clean lines and precise trimming for mustaches, beards, and sideburns. As male grooming gains prominence through media influence and changing lifestyle preferences, men are increasingly investing in compact, easy-to-use grooming tools. Shaving pens serve as versatile solutions for maintaining a well-groomed appearance with minimal effort.

Distribution Channel Insights

Offline retail remains a significant distribution channel, especially in emerging markets where the in-store experience influences purchasing decisions. Consumers often prefer testing grooming products before buying, making pharmacies, supermarkets, and specialty beauty stores key points of sale. Offline retailers also provide instant product availability and the opportunity for personal consultation. The segment benefits from brand visibility and impulse purchases, contributing to consistent sales in both urban and semi-urban regions.

Braun GmbH, a German consumer products company founded in 1921, is a key player in the grooming and personal care market. Known for its innovation in electric shaving technology, Braun is recognized for high-precision, durable grooming tools including electric shavers, trimmers, and stylers. Now a subsidiary of Procter & Gamble, Braun emphasizes German engineering, ergonomic design, and advanced features like AutoSense technology and precision heads, making it a trusted global brand in male grooming and personal care solutions.

  • In June 2025, Braun launched its new Series 9 Pro+ (model 96xx), which is their most advanced electric shaver yet. It features AutoSense, adapting to beard density, 10,000 sonic vibrations, five synchronized shaving elements and a surgical‑grade Precision ProTrimmer. With a 6‑in‑1 SmartCare cleaning/charging station and PowerCase included, it delivers ultra‑close, comfortable performance.
